Understanding the Role of Shipping Centers
Shipping centers are the backbone of cargo transportation. They serve as critical hubs for the movement of goods, facilitating the flow from manufacturers to consumers. These centers are designed to streamline operations, enhance logistics, and improve overall transport efficiencies.
Importance of Professional Shipping Centers
Utilizing professional shipping centers can lead to numerous advantages for businesses, such as:
- Centralized Operations: Shipping centers bring together various processes, including sorting, storing, and dispatching cargo which reduces the overall time for goods to reach their destination.
- Cost Efficiency: By leveraging the scale of operations, businesses can benefit from reduced shipping costs through optimized routes and consolidated shipments.
- Enhanced Tracking: Modern shipping centers utilize state-of-the-art technology that enables real-time tracking of goods, ensuring transparency and reliability for customers.
- Expertise: Shipping centers are staffed with logistics experts who understand the intricacies of cargo management and can provide valuable insights on best practices.
The Dynamics of Transportation Logistics
Transportation logistics encompasses the planning and execution of the movement of goods. It ensures that products are delivered in the right quantity, at the right time, and at the right place. This complex process consists of optimizing routes, managing inventory, and coordinating between various distribution channels.
Key Components of Transportation Logistics
To develop a successful transportation strategy, businesses should focus on the following components:
- Route Optimization: Choosing efficient routes reduces costs and transit times. Logistics management software can assist in mapping the best paths for transport.
- Inventory Management: Keeping an optimal level of stock ensures that there are no delays in fulfillment, which can be achieved through effective forecasting and demand planning.
- Carrier Selection: Evaluating and selecting the right carriers is essential for ensuring that goods arrive safely and on time, balancing cost versus service quality.
- Regulatory Compliance: Understanding the laws and regulations governing cargo transportation is crucial. Compliance ensures smooth operations and avoids potential legal hurdles.
Strategic Operations at Airports
Airports play a pivotal role in the transportation of cargo over long distances. Air freight is often the preferred method for high-value or time-sensitive goods, where speed is of the essence. The efficiency of air cargo operations directly impacts the global supply chain.
Benefits of Air Freight in Cargo Transportation
The advantages of utilizing air freight for cargo transportation include:
- Speed: With the capability to transport goods across continents in just a few hours, air freight is unbeatable for urgent shipments.
- Accessibility: Airports are widely dispersed, allowing for quick access to international markets and remote locations.
- Advanced Handling: Airport facilities are equipped to handle sensitive and perishable goods, ensuring their safe passage.
- Global Reach: Air freight can connect businesses to markets around the world, expanding their reach and opportunities.
The Future of Cargo Booking and Transportation
As technology evolves, so does the landscape of cargo transportation. Innovations like automated logistics systems, AI-driven analytics, and blockchain technology are shaping the future of how goods are transported. These advancements enhance efficiency, tracking, and security, reducing costs and improving service delivery.
Embracing Technology in Shipping
Using advanced technology can give businesses a significant edge in the highly competitive shipping industry. Some key technologies driving this change include:
- Internet of Things (IoT): IoT devices can provide real-time data on the location and condition of shipments, aiding in proactive decision-making.
- Artificial Intelligence: AI can optimize routing, predict demand, and enhance customer service through chatbots and personalized experiences.
- Blockchain: This technology ensures transparency and security in transactions, allowing for better trust between stakeholders in the supply chain.
